hMG

Meaning

hMG, which stands for Human Menopausal Gonadotropin, is a clinical pharmaceutical preparation containing a mixture of the gonadotropin hormones, specifically Follicle-Stimulating Hormone (FSH) and Luteinizing Hormone (LH). This agent is primarily used in reproductive endocrinology to directly stimulate gonadal function, promoting ovarian follicle development in women undergoing fertility treatments or inducing spermatogenesis in men with certain forms of hypogonadism. It is a critical component of assisted reproductive technology, serving to bypass deficiencies in endogenous pituitary hormone secretion.
